aboutsummaryrefslogtreecommitdiffstats
path: root/devel
diff options
context:
space:
mode:
authorkuriyama <kuriyama@FreeBSD.org>2012-10-20 11:08:34 +0800
committerkuriyama <kuriyama@FreeBSD.org>2012-10-20 11:08:34 +0800
commite54943276bc5a1f872af5a9adcdbcd8628763b23 (patch)
treeb86a57a9729e899f36b11571c9a635b0804bc124 /devel
parent1deb4588d8af6562c950d3615fc367ab90bd9952 (diff)
downloadfreebsd-ports-gnome-e54943276bc5a1f872af5a9adcdbcd8628763b23.tar.gz
freebsd-ports-gnome-e54943276bc5a1f872af5a9adcdbcd8628763b23.tar.zst
freebsd-ports-gnome-e54943276bc5a1f872af5a9adcdbcd8628763b23.zip
Stream::Buffered is a buffer class to store arbitrary length of byte
strings and then get a seekable filehandle once everything is buffered. It uses PerlIO and/or temporary file to save the buffer depending on the length of the size. WWW: http://search.cpan.org/dist/Stream-Buffered/ Feature safe: yes
Diffstat (limited to 'devel')
-rw-r--r--devel/Makefile1
-rw-r--r--devel/p5-Stream-Buffered/Makefile16
-rw-r--r--devel/p5-Stream-Buffered/distinfo2
-rw-r--r--devel/p5-Stream-Buffered/pkg-descr6
-rw-r--r--devel/p5-Stream-Buffered/pkg-plist9
5 files changed, 34 insertions, 0 deletions
diff --git a/devel/Makefile b/devel/Makefile
index 959a801e3f5c..189d2e53e33f 100644
--- a/devel/Makefile
+++ b/devel/Makefile
@@ -2536,6 +2536,7 @@
SUBDIR += p5-Spoon
SUBDIR += p5-Storable
SUBDIR += p5-Stream
+ SUBDIR += p5-Stream-Buffered
SUBDIR += p5-Stream-Reader
SUBDIR += p5-String-Approx
SUBDIR += p5-String-CRC32
diff --git a/devel/p5-Stream-Buffered/Makefile b/devel/p5-Stream-Buffered/Makefile
new file mode 100644
index 000000000000..a79c94aa74bd
--- /dev/null
+++ b/devel/p5-Stream-Buffered/Makefile
@@ -0,0 +1,16 @@
+# $FreeBSD$
+
+PORTNAME= Stream-Buffered
+PORTVERSION= 0.02
+CATEGORIES= devel perl5
+MASTER_SITES= CPAN
+PKGNAMEPREFIX= p5-
+
+MAINTAINER= kuriyama@FreeBSD.org
+COMMENT= Perl extension for temporary buffer to save bytes
+
+PERL_CONFIGURE= yes
+
+MAN3= Stream::Buffered.3
+
+.include <bsd.port.mk>
diff --git a/devel/p5-Stream-Buffered/distinfo b/devel/p5-Stream-Buffered/distinfo
new file mode 100644
index 000000000000..91267624e34f
--- /dev/null
+++ b/devel/p5-Stream-Buffered/distinfo
@@ -0,0 +1,2 @@
+SHA256 (Stream-Buffered-0.02.tar.gz) = 596e93fca06956d7864710bd587219fc9119c12c439c1c1acb2bfb7c051cca2d
+SIZE (Stream-Buffered-0.02.tar.gz) = 22215
diff --git a/devel/p5-Stream-Buffered/pkg-descr b/devel/p5-Stream-Buffered/pkg-descr
new file mode 100644
index 000000000000..e32ada770dc1
--- /dev/null
+++ b/devel/p5-Stream-Buffered/pkg-descr
@@ -0,0 +1,6 @@
+Stream::Buffered is a buffer class to store arbitrary length of byte
+strings and then get a seekable filehandle once everything is
+buffered. It uses PerlIO and/or temporary file to save the buffer
+depending on the length of the size.
+
+WWW: http://search.cpan.org/dist/Stream-Buffered/
diff --git a/devel/p5-Stream-Buffered/pkg-plist b/devel/p5-Stream-Buffered/pkg-plist
new file mode 100644
index 000000000000..dd21b4144b59
--- /dev/null
+++ b/devel/p5-Stream-Buffered/pkg-plist
@@ -0,0 +1,9 @@
+%%SITE_PERL%%/%%PERL_ARCH%%/auto/Stream/Buffered/.packlist
+%%SITE_PERL%%/Stream/Buffered.pm
+%%SITE_PERL%%/Stream/Buffered/Auto.pm
+%%SITE_PERL%%/Stream/Buffered/File.pm
+%%SITE_PERL%%/Stream/Buffered/PerlIO.pm
+@dirrm %%SITE_PERL%%/Stream/Buffered
+@dirrmtry %%SITE_PERL%%/Stream
+@dirrm %%SITE_PERL%%/%%PERL_ARCH%%/auto/Stream/Buffered
+@dirrmtry %%SITE_PERL%%/%%PERL_ARCH%%/auto/Stream